Location For U.S. Open in Table Tennis for the next three years is announced

Grand Rapids, MI, United States – Devos Place Convention Center is set to again host the U.S Open table tennis championships twice in the next three years following its successful staging of the biggest table tennis event in the United States last year, USA Table Tennis confirmed Thursday.

USA Table Tennis CEO Michael Cavanaugh announced DeVos Place, located in downtown Grand Rapids, will once again hold the US Open table tennis championship in 2012 and 2014, with the Milwaukee staging the 2013 edition.

USA Table Tennis legend Dell Sweeris, who joined forces with the West Michigan Sports Commission in brining the championship back in Grand Rapids, is expecting a much bigger tournament due to a longer preparation time of 15 months.

Last year, DeVos Place had only six months to prepare but still came up with a successful tournament, drawing 700 paddlers from 16 nations and providing $600,000 to the Grand Rapids’ economy.

Sweeris also envisions the tournament becoming a major sports event like the prestigious US Open championships in golf and tennis.

“I don’t want it to say that this is like the U.S. Open in golf and the U.S. Open in tennis yet, but that’s the direction I would like to challenge our community to get to,” Sweeris told Michigan Live.com Thursday.

West Michigan Sports Commission’s executive director Mike Guswiler added the experience they gained from hosting last year’s US Open championship will give them an edge in finding more sponsors and awareness on what it takes to host the event.
